How do we know that God sees our actions?

Answered in 3 sources

Scripture consistently affirms that God sees all, even the hidden actions of the wicked, as stated in Psalms 94:7.

The belief that God is unaware of our actions is a common misconception among the wicked, as highlighted in Psalm 94:7, which says, 'They say, The Lord does not see; the God of Jacob pays no heed.' This reveals a willful ignorance of God's omniscience. Throughout the Bible, numerous passages stress that God does indeed observe and is aware of every action and thought. Such knowledge serves as a basis for His righteous judgment; thus, the idea that one can escape God's watchful eye is both erroneous and dangerous. Psalm 139 further reinforces this by declaring that there is nowhere we can go to flee from God's presence.
Scripture References: Psalm 94:7, Psalm 139, Matthew 6:4, Matthew 6:6, Psalm 139:1-4
